This quaint little holiday home was previously part of a working farm, and today its charming stone walls contain a stylish dwelling with space for one or two. It’s in a lovely spot surrounded by nature and walking trails, with car-free access to two of the Lake District’s 214 Wainwrights, Little Mell Fell (1 mile) or Gowbarrow Fell (2.5 miles). Locally, enjoy a drink of local ale at the friendly pub 1 mile away, or head to the waterfront hotel (1.5 miles) for an indulgent spa treatment and scenic swim.

Enter the glass doors into a welcoming open-plan living area, complete with a comfy sofa, footstool, and TV with Sky channels. The decor blends contemporary facilities with original features such as ceiling beams and atmospheric vaulted ceilings. Cook up fried breakfasts and yummy dinners in the sweet farmhouse kitchen, complete with apron sink, then sit down to romantic meals at the wooden table. The super-king-size bedroom features a DAB radio, and an en-suite bathroom with a shower over the bath. In good weather, make the most of the cottage’s enclosed seating area, featuring a fire pit to keep you cosy. You can admire stunning views of Little Mell Fell and Priest Crag as you sip your morning coffee or nightcap.

There’s so much to do nearby, whether that’s admiring the popular Aira Force waterfalls (4.5 miles) part of the Ullswater Way, or climbing the majestic Helvellyn, England's third-highest peak (7 miles). The friendly village of Pooley Bridge (3 miles) is well worth a visit, with its cafés, shops and tourist information centre. If you’re lucky, you may even be able to enjoy a day’s skiing (15 miles).
